Hybrid cloud solutions are reshaping the IT landscape for APAC enterprises, balancing the flexibility and scalability of public clouds and the control and security of private clouds.
FREMONT, CA: The Asia Pacific (APAC) region takes pride in some of the world's most rapidly expanding economies, prompting businesses to increasingly turn to hybrid cloud solutions to meet their evolving requirements. Hybrid cloud solutions seamlessly amalgamate the advantages of both public and private cloud services, providing businesses with the much-needed flexibility, scalability, and security to thrive.
Projections from a report by MarketsandMarkets estimate that by 2023, the hybrid cloud market in APAC will surge to USD 40 billion. This remarkable growth can be attributed to several key drivers, including the growing adoption of digital technologies among regional businesses, the imperative for enterprises to establish a more adaptable and scalable IT infrastructure, and the determination of businesses to retain control over their data and applications.
Hybrid cloud solutions offer several benefits for APAC enterprises, including:
Flexibility: Hybrid cloud solutions allow businesses to choose the right cloud platform for each workload based on cost, performance, and security requirements.
Scalability: Hybrid cloud solutions can be scaled up or down to meet changing business needs.
This is especially important for businesses in the APAC region, which are experiencing rapid growth.
Security: Hybrid cloud solutions can help businesses improve their security posture by providing a way to isolate sensitive data and applications from the public cloud.
Cost Savings: Hybrid cloud solutions can help businesses to save money on IT costs by allowing them to only pay for the cloud resources they need.
Use Cases for Hybrid Cloud in APAC
Hybrid cloud solutions can be used for a variety of workloads in the APAC region, including:
Application Development and Testing: Hybrid cloud solutions can be used to develop and test new applications in a secure and isolated environment. Once the applications are ready for production, they can be deployed to the public cloud.
Data Analytics and Machine Learning: Solutions can store and process large amounts of data for analytics and machine learning workloads. The public cloud can be used for compute-intensive tasks, while the private cloud can store sensitive data.
Disaster recovery and backup: Hybrid solutions can be used to implement disaster recovery and backup plans. The public cloud can be used to store backups of data and applications, while the private cloud can be used to host disaster recovery environments.
Adoption of Hybrid Cloud in APAC
APAC is witnessing a substantial surge in adopting hybrid cloud solutions. A significant 70 per cent of businesses in this region have already incorporated or intend to implement hybrid cloud solutions within the coming year. This accelerating trend can be attributed to a range of influential factors. Firstly, there is a growing awareness among businesses about the advantages that hybrid cloud technology offers. Additionally, the market is enriched with a diverse selection of hybrid cloud solutions offered by domestic and international vendors. This provides organisations with a broad spectrum of choices to cater to their specific needs. Furthermore, governments in the APAC region are actively endorsing and supporting the adoption of cloud computing, further propelling the adoption of hybrid cloud solutions.
